Ruth Harris is a scholar working on Geophysics, Artificial Intelligence and Geology. According to data from OpenAlex, Ruth Harris has authored 66 papers receiving a total of 4.8k ind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 51 papers in Geophysics, 22 papers in Artificial Intelligence and 5 papers in Geology. Recurrent topics in Ruth Harris’s work include earthquake and tectonic studies (46 papers), High-pressure geophysics and materials (24 papers) and Seismology and Earthquake Studies (18 papers). Ruth Harris is often cited by papers focused on earthquake and tectonic studies (46 papers), High-pressure geophysics and materials (24 papers) and Seismology and Earthquake Studies (18 papers). Ruth Harris collaborates with scholars based in United States, United Kingdom and New Zealand. Ruth Harris's co-authors include Steven M. Day, Robert W. Simpson, P. Segall, Paul A. Reasenberg, Ralph J. Archuleta, Joan Gomberg, Paul Bodin, D. J. Andrews, D. D. Oglesby and J. R. Murray and has published in prestigious journals such as Nature, Science and Journal of Geophysical Research Atmospheres.
